Monitoring opencast mine restorations using Unmanned Aerial System (UAS) imagery

2019 
Abstract Open-pit mine is still an unavoidable activity but can become unsustainable without the restoration of degraded sites. Monitoring the restoration after extractive activities is a legal requirement for mine companies and public administrations in many countries, involving financial provisions for environmental liabilities.
